2. In-depth analysis of mainstream finished NAS systems

(1) Synology DSM System: The Ecological King of "Stability"

Synology's DiskStation Manager (DSM) system is the "iOS" of NAS world, known for its stability and ecological integrity, and is the first choice for professional users when paired with popular models such as DS925+.

Core Strengths:

  • Ease of use: The interface is simple and intuitive, and the backup process is highly automated, so even novices can get started quickly without complex configuration.

  • ecosystem is powerful: Synology Photos' photo management capabilities are the benchmark in the industry, supporting intelligent classification and lossless backup, which perfectly adapts to the needs of photographers. Native applications such as Drive and Active Backup cover file synchronization and cross-device backup, and enterprise-level functions such as team sharing and permission management are all available.

  • Outstanding

    stability: Low long-term operation failure rate, complete data protection mechanism, support for multiple RAID modes, and snapshot function to effectively avoid data loss.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• Low cost performance: the price under the same configuration is significantly higher than that of domestic models and DIY solutions, and the hardware cost higher;

  • Strong system closure: Although stability is guaranteed, the playability is insufficient, and the customization needs of advanced players are limited.

Suitable for: Home users, professional photographers/designers, and small businesses seeking peace of mind and stability, suitable for scenarios that require reliable data backup and team collaboration.

(2) QNAP QTS System: A Toss Paradise for "Hardcore Players"

QN's QTS system is labeled as "high degree of freedom and strong expandability", and with models such as the QUI-405, it has become the preferred choice for hardware gamers and technology enthusiasts.

Core Strengths :

  • highly playable: fully supports Docker container and virtual machine deployment, comes with high-speed VPN function, and can expand rich functions through plug-ins to meet the personalized needs of high-end users;

  • Flexible hardware expansion: supports PCIe card upgrade LAN ports (up to 25G rate), and some models are equipped with M.2 NVMe slots for flexible storage and transfer performance.

  • Multi-scenario adaptation: Taking into account both home audio and video and enterprise office, it supports ARM NEON video hardware transcoding, and can be used to build various applications such as media centers and servers with Docker.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• high entry threshold: the system functions are complicated, the interface logic is not as intuitive as Synology, and novices need to have a certain learning cost;

  • Frequent system updates: Feature stacking leads to slightly inferior stability in some scenarios, and redundant functions may increase operational complexity.

suitable for : technical players who like to toss around, users who need to deploy Docker and virtual machines, small businesses with high requirements for scalability, suitable for scenarios that pursue "one machine for multiple purposes".

(3) Greenlink UGOS Pro System: "Appearance and Cost-effectiveness" for home use

Greenlink has risen rapidly in the past two years with the UGOS Pro system, with "simple to use, cost-effective hardware" as its selling point, with DXP4800, DH4300 Plus and other models to accurately hit the needs of home users.

Core Strengths:

  • Beginner-friendly: The interface is clean and simple, ready to use out of the box, NFC one-touch connection function simplifies the first configuration process, and detailed function descriptions and nanny-style tutorials are provided in the system;

  • AI Smart blessing: Support local AI face recognition, intelligent photo album classification, automatic deduplication function adapted to Apple devices, photo backup is efficient and worry-free;

  • Cost-effective: solid hardware configuration, entry-level models can be started for less than 1,000 yuan, and high-end models are lower than international brands with the same performance;

  • Excellent AV Experience: Equipped with an HDMI port that supports 4K HDR output, compatible with various video formats, making it easy to create a home audio center.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• ecosystem is still growing: the richness of the software ecosystem is not as good as that of Synology and QNAP, and some professional functions (such as enterprise-level permission management) support are limited;

  • compatibility needs to be improved: third-party application adaptation is not as comprehensive as that of established brands, and high-end gameplay needs to wait for subsequent system optimization.

Suitable for: Home audio-visual parties, photography enthusiasts, and novice NAS users, suitable for home storage scenarios that pursue cost-effective, plug-and-play use.

(four) pole space ZOS system: an all-rounder with "full performance"

With "high performance and integrated experience" as the core, the

Space ZOS system is paired with models such as the Z4Pro + Performance Edition to take into account both home entertainment and light office needs, becoming the backbone of domestic NAS.

Core Strengths:

  • Strong performance: The flagship model is equipped with an Intel i3-N305 processor (8 cores and 8 threads), 16GB DDR5 memory, fast file transfer and video transcoding speed, and smooth multitasking;

  • clear operation logic: the UI design is beautiful, and the local album, video, and backup functions are integrated, so there is no need to switch between multiple applications, and the user experience is coherent.

  • device adaptation: The new Apple device is optimized in place, supports multiple devices to access at the same time, and the family sharing function is convenient, suitable for multi-member use.

shortcomings and limitations :

  • Weak enterprise-level ecology: insufficient brand precipitation, limited support for enterprise-level functions (such as dual power supply and large-scale redundancy), making it difficult to meet the needs of large enterprises;

  • Lack of deep gameplay: Although high-end features such as Docker support are launched, they are not as optimized as QNAP, and professional users may find the playability insufficient.

Suitable for : High-performance home players, users who need to take care of both audio-visual and backup, novices who pursue one-step approach, suitable for families and small studios with performance requirements.

3. In-depth analysis of popular free DIY NAS systems

For users who pursue high cost performance and like customization, DIY assembly hardware with a free NAS system solution can not only flexibly choose the configuration, but also save costs.

(1) TrueNAS Scale/Core: The Open Source Benchmark for "Enterprise Performance"

Formerly known as FreeNAS,

TrueNAS is divided into Linux-based Scale version and FreeBSD-based Core version, which is a representative of enterprise-level features in open source NAS systems.

core strengths:

  • data security is full: Equipped with a powerful ZFS file system, it supports snapshot, cloning, and data replication functions, which can protect data from the risk of loss in real time, and cooperate with the verification mechanism to ensure data integrity.

  • Strong scalability: TrueNAS Scale supports KVM virtualization and Docker container deployment, is compatible with Kubernetes, and can build complex service clusters to meet enterprise-level application deployment needs.

  • Outstanding Performance: Optimized for high-speed storage devices (such as NVMe hard drives) and 10,000-gigabit NICs, the sequential read and write speed far exceeds that of ordinary home NAS, making it suitable for large-scale data storage.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• Demanding hardware requirements: It is recommended to be equipped with more than 32GB of memory, and it is recommended to use ECC memory to ensure stability, and it also has high requirements for CPU performance, and the hardware cost is not low.

  • Difficult configuration: The system functions are biased towards professional level, the interface logic is complex, and a certain foundation of Linux/FreeBSD operation is required, and the learning curve for novices is steep.

  • No native mobile app: The remote access experience is not as good as the finished NAS, so you need to configure third-party tools by yourself.

Applicable people: Enthusiasts with solid technical skills, small enterprises, and data centers, suitable for large-scale storage and virtualization deployment scenarios with extremely high data security requirements.

(2) OpenMediaVault (OMV): "Lightweight and all-round" cost-effective choice

Developed on Debian Linux,

OpenMediaVault (OMV) is a lightweight and open-source NAS system that is completely free and highly compatible, adapting to high-performance hosts and running smoothly on low-power devices such as Raspberry Pi, making it a popular choice for home DIY.

Core Strengths:

  • Low hardware threshold: loose configuration requirements, old computers, mini hosts and even raspberry pies can be installed, and the hardware cost can be controlled within hundreds of yuan, suitable for using idle hardware to build;

  • Rich Plugin Ecosystem: Supports expanding functions through plugins, including Samba file sharing, FTP services, Plex media center, Docker deployment, etc., to meet the diverse needs of families.

  • stable and reliable: Based on the Debian kernel, the long-term operation failure rate is low, the resource occupation is low, and the electricity cost of low-power devices is low throughout the year.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• Interface is simple: the operation interface is relatively old, not as intuitive as the commercial system, and some advanced functions need to be configured through the command line, increasing the learning cost;

  • Chinese Limited support: Most of the official documentation is in English, and although the community resources are active, the Chinese tutorials are relatively fragmented, making it a bit difficult for novices to get started.

  • Lack of intelligent functions: Lack of home-based intelligent functions such as AI photo albums and automatic scraping of movies and television, and the audio and video experience is not as good as the finished NAS.

applicable people: Home users with limited budgets, technology enthusiasts who like to toss, idle hardware reuse scenarios, suitable for basic file sharing, simple media center construction needs.

(3) Flying Bull FnOS: "Beginner-friendly" domestic free plan

Feiniu FnOS is an emerging domestic free NAS system, deeply developed based on the latest Linux kernel, taking into account ease of use and scalability, simple installation and wide hardware compatibility, accurately hitting the DIY needs of home users.

Core Strengths :

  • low difficulty to get started: the installation process is similar to Windows, the image can be written to the USB flash drive to start, no need for complex boot configuration, the Chinese interface is intuitive and easy to understand, and novices can quickly complete the construction;

  • Wide hardware compatibility: Supports a wide range of x86 devices, from old notebooks to high-performance mini hosts, and can be adapted to low-power processors such as J3160 and N100 without specific hardware.

  • complete home functions: built-in AI album search, automatic film and television scraping (99% accuracy), intranet penetration and other practical functions to meet the needs of home audio, video and photo backup, and completely free of charge with no hidden fees;

  • Low power consumption and energy saving: The working power consumption is only 18-28 watts, only 2.1 watts in the shutdown state, and the annual electricity bill is less than 15 yuan, suitable for long-term operation.

shortcomings and limitations:

  • The

    ecosystem is still growing: the application ecosystem is not as rich as that of old systems, and the support for professional functions (such as enterprise-level permission management and virtualization) is limited;

  • stability to be verified: As an emerging system, version iterations are frequent, and some functions are still being improved, so the stability of long-term operation needs to be further observed.

  • Lack of Expansion Depth: Although Docker support is live, it is not as optimized as TrueNAS and OMV, and high-end gameplay is limited.

Suitable for : Home users, NAS novices, and DIY enthusiasts with limited budgets, suitable for lightweight scenarios such as home audio and video storage and daily data backup.

4. Horizontal comparison and purchase suggestions

mainstream NAS Horizontal comparison of system core parameters

System Type core advantages core shortcomings hardware costs applicable scenarios
Honor DSM Ecological stability, strong ease of use, full of professional functions high price and average playability medium and high (4000 yuan +) professional creation, enterprise office, stable backup
Wei Unicom QTS highly scalable, highly playable, and feature-rich difficult to get started, the system is a bit messy medium (3000 yuan +) technology toss, Docker deployment, enterprise scaling,
UGOS Pro Beginner-friendly, cost-effective, AI-intelligent ecology is shallow and compatibility is average medium and low (1000 yuan +) home audio, daily backup, Apple user
Space ZOS Strong performance, smooth operation, and perfect adaptation enterprise ecology is weak and in-depth gameplay is insufficient medium (3000 yuan +) high-performance needs of the home, AV + backup integration
TrueNAS enterprise-grade data protection with outstanding performance high hardware requirements and complex configuration medium and high (5000 yuan +) data centers, virtualization, mass storage
OpenMediaVault Free and open source, low hardware threshold, and wide compatibility interface is rudimentary and requires command-line extension low (500 yuan +) idle hardware utilization, basic file sharing
Flying Bull FnOS Free, easy to use, low power consumption, full of home functions ecology needs to grow, professional functions are weak low (300 yuan +) home video, daily backup, newbie DIY

Precise Shopping Guide

  1. pursue peace of mind, stability, and budget : Choose Synology DSM System (DS925+) to provide a worry-free experience whether it is a long-term home backup or a light enterprise office.
  2. like to toss and pursue custom : choose the Weiwei Unicom QTS system (Qu-405) or TrueNAS, the former has flexible hardware expansion, and the latter has strong data security, suitable for unlocking the full potential of NAS;
  3. for home use, cost-effective priority : the finished product chooses Greenlink UGOS Pro (DH4300 Plus entry), DIY chooses Feiniu FnOS, the former is plug-and-play, and the latter is free and low-power, all of which meet the needs of the family;
  4. idle hardware utilization with limited budget : Choose OpenMediaVault, which supports low-configuration devices, is free and open source, and has sufficient functions, suitable for basic storage scenarios.
  5. value performance, one machine for multiple purposes: finished product selection space ZOS (Z4Pro + performance version), DIY choice of TrueNAS Scale, the former for smooth operation, and the latter supports virtualization to meet high-performance needs.
